What is the vertex of the quadratic function f(x)=(x-8)(x-2)

Respuesta :

gmany
gmany gmany
  • 15-09-2018

[tex]f(x)=(x-8)(x-2)\\\\x-intercept\\\\f(x)=0\to x-8=0\ \vee\ x-2=0\\\\x=8,\ x=2[/tex]

The vertex x-coordinate is in the middle between the x-intercepts

Therefore

[tex]x=\dfrac{8+2}{2}=\dfrac{10}{2}=5[/tex]

The vertex y-coordinate is equal the value of function for x = 5:

[tex]f(5)=(5-8)(5-2)=(-3)(3)=-9[/tex]

Answer: (5, -9)
